The history of Imperial Kannauj marks a crucial transition in Ancient Indian history, illustrating the shift in power from the once-dominant Gupta Empire to a fierce regional contest. This story chronicles the rise of the Maukharis, the consolidation under Harshavardhana, and the intense Tripartite Struggle for dominance involving the Pratiharas, Palas, and Rashtrakutas between 785–816 CE. Understanding these dynamics is vital for students preparing for competitive exams, as it details the political fragmentation and subsequent realignment that defined the early medieval period in North India.
